Kangangamashumi eminyaka, amatye akhiwe ngobunjineli ayelawula izinto zangaphakathi zodidi oluphezulu kunye nobuhle obuphefumlelwe yiCarrara. Sekunjalo, emva kwemithambo efana nemarble kwakufihliwe imfihlo ebulalayo: i-crystalline silica (RCS) ephefumlayo. Xa isikiwe okanye ipolishiwe, iindawo ze-quartz zemveli zikhupha amasuntswana amahle kakhulu (<4μm) angena kwizicubu zemiphunga, nto leyo ebangela i-silicosis engenakuguqulwa - ngoku echazwa yi-WHO njenge "sifo esiphambili somsebenzi." Ukuvalwa kwelitye le-silica ephezulu e-Australia ngo-2023 kwaphawula utshintsho olukhulu kushishino.ICarrara 0 Ilitye leSilica: ayikokuvumelana, kodwa kukutsiba okukhulu kwisayensi yezinto eziphathekayo.
